    Oceansfull Festival is active on Test!

    For generations, we othmir have been giving thanks to Prexus at this time of year for all he provides, above and beneath the waves. Know that if you find any of us celebrating along the oceans' edge, like Taffil in Antonica, Hana in Tranquil Sea, or Kisu in Eastern Wastes, you are welcome to dance with us and receive our blessings. I’ve heard it can be fortuitous when searching the waters nearby for evidence of the Ocean Lord’s generosity.

    Mimmi has returned to Nipik’s Haven in Eastern Wastes shaken by events she witnessed and seeking mighty heroes. Give her a moment of your time, won’t you? May Prexus bless you in return!

    New Features for '23!
    Special Rules Servers
    • Varsoon - The event is active, with the following exceptions (due to expansion availability):
      • To Shell and Back, Sounds of The Sea, Terrors Run Deep, “Awuidor: Trench of Terrors”, and Oceansfull of Good Food.
    • Zarrakon - The event is active, with the following exceptions (due to expansion availability):
      • Salt Encrusted Treasure Hunt, To Shell and Back, Sounds of The Sea, Terrors Run Deep, "Awuidor: Trench of Terrors", and Oceansfull of Good Food.
    • Kael Drakkel - The event is active, with the following exceptions (due to expansion availability):
      • Oceansfull of Good Food
    Live servers
    • New quest!
      • Salt Encrusted Treasure Hunt – available as loot from clam shell game
    • Adjusted adventure quest!
      • Terrors Run Deep offered by Mimmi at Nipik's Haven in Eastern Wastes is now available to all levels!
    • New level scaling version of ’22 dungeon, for characters under level 119.
      • Awuidor: Trench of Terrors
    • New collection!
      • Sounds of The Sea - Available in all “Awuidor: Trench of Terrors” dungeons
    • Clam Shell Game has 33 items (12 of which are brand new, including a new building block set!)
      • Also includes Silver Jubilation Medals during Summer Jubilee
    Returning Features:
    • in-game mail to announce the event and summarize location of quest givers.
    • Oceansfull Celebrators are found dancing and setting off fireworks along the coast in 11 different zones.
    • Clam Shell Game - Players open clam shells found offshore in areas of the world where Oceansfull Celebrators are found to obtain prizes.
    • Overseer quests
      • Offered by Taffil in Antonica
        • Yodie’s Adventure - Kedge Curiosity
        • Yodie’s Adventure - Merchant of Trouble
        • Yodie’s Adventure - Wakey Wakey
    • Quests
      • Terrors Run Deep - Repeatable every year
      • Oceansfull of Good Food - Repeatable every year
      • To Shell and Back - Repeatable every year
      • Shell or High Water - Repeatable every year
      • Beach Party Brawl - Repeatable every year
    • Collections
      • Sacraments of the Deep
    Any feedback submitted after 8/6/2023 may not be received in time to be taken into account for this year.

    This event content is currently set to run 8/10/2023 at 12:01 AM PT until 8/23/2023 at 11:59 PM PT on the live servers.

    There is an odd visual bug with the new Opaline building block set. The south and west facing sides look textured, but the north and east facing sides look smooth. If I rotate the blocks, it's the same so the direction you're viewing from is what shows a texture, or not. So, looking at it from the south side, it looks smooth, looking at it from the north side, it has a heavy texture. (And this is purely personal taste, it actually looks better smooth. With the texture it's way too busy. )

    Now, with the only problems I had, I am not sure if all or some of them are bugs, or intended, and just the downside to this content. For one, I ran the zone twice on this toon to be sure. (Note, this illy has never done this content before on test.)
    I did the quest, and then reset and ran the zone again, just to make sure the issues were consistent.

    Additionally, I had my TS prestige tracking on the whole time, and save for one situation, NOTHING turned up on tracking. None of the harvestable rocks turned up, nor did I see any nodes throughout. None of the fish nodes turned up, nor did I see any. None of the original shiny collection showed up either. Mind you, I turned tracking off and back on, multiple times just in case, and left on the WHOLE time and nothing showed up until the end when: I got all 4 pearls placed on pods and the last area opened up. As soon as I did that, a NEW shiny/collectible showed up very close to the entrance. It showed up in tracking, and I was able to see the blue bubble of it. It gave me the one collectible from the *new collection*.

    Then, upon defeating the final boss, one more shiny showed up, from that same new collection. Trouble is, it was a *repeat* of the same one I had just found upstairs near the entry to the last section. So I got TWO of the same one.

    That was it! No other shinies showed up in the entire zone. (Whether on tracking or by sight.) Not even the final area after evac. When you go back and fight those three weird critters at the back end. That last shiny on top of the coral never showed up. I checked BOTH tracking, and by manual searching/view. So, to sum up, nothing showed on tracking, not a node, not a fishing node, not a shiny, nothing, until those last 2 at end.

    The reason I tried a second run, was in case you were intending to unlock shinies with the first run/quest. Still same results as above. Nada but last two, both times the second of the two shinies were repeat of first one (2 each run, one of each being repeat.) I hope you did not intend one run first to open shinies. That would kinda stink because that zone takes awhile, and running on multiple toons gets VERY tedious. Some rewards aside from quest completion would be good. But if you did intend, keep in mind that fact above, that nothing else showed up at all.

    Also, on another note, for some reason, NONE of the mobs dropped ANY loot besides the 5 bosses. Last year, they had the occasional so-so reward, or at best some junk drops. For example, the Fathomlurkers dropped NOTHING and I tried many of them. Not a single Lore and Legend update, not a single Lore and Legend drop. Not even a single 2 copper junk item from ANY mob. Something seems wrong there. Like somehow turning on the new collectibles shut everything else off. o_O And even with the new shinies...did you intend to get ONE single shiny, and one dupe per run? (Hope not.) That seems harsh.

    Thank you to all who dove right in to testing this holiday content!

    I've got a few changes that are headed to Test. Watch for the following changes to be listed in Test update notes:
    • Petamorph Wand: Brackish Seahag – Preview window should now function correctly.
    • Poisonous Mudhopper – Available house pet commands should now all function correctly.
    • Black Perch Plushie – Plushie can now be scaled larger.
    Be sure to note any other feedback or bugs you encounter!

    It is intended that you get two collectibles per dungeon run, though which collectibles you get are random. You just happened to get two of the same in one run. Bad Bristlebane! (The amount of collection pieces available per run are comparable to Doomfire: Ro's Sweatshop, the Level 1-119 Scorched Sky dungeon introduced this year, too.)


    Last year's Awuidor: Trench of Terrors [solo] dungeon was a level 120+ exclusive dungeon. Its challenge was ramped up and as such the mobs in there did have an opportunity to drop loot. That is not the case for a level scaling dungeon such as this. Again, this Oceansfull Festival dungeon is more comparable to Doomfire: Ro's Sweatshop, the Level 1-119 Scorched Sky dungeon.

    That said, racial loot should still have a chance to drop in Awuidor: Trench of Terrors, and you are right that the fathomlurkers were not set up to drop for anyone below level 120. D'oh! I'll see if I can fix that, and I'll take a look at the other racial loot in here, too. I'm sure you're not the only one who would appreciate a chance for that loot to drop.
